Output 905f26e079132ffd2083aac1e445f80ab95d247365e2506819aa71e2b2efc53c:0

value
433532
script pubkey
OP_0 OP_PUSHBYTES_20 90143b7efea56850e5d6443c4f25ceba00caafb3
address
ltc1qjq2rklh75459pewkgs7y7fwwhgqv4tangazd0m
transaction
905f26e079132ffd2083aac1e445f80ab95d247365e2506819aa71e2b2efc53c
spent
true